Recording

''Mullet Fever'' was created and recorded in the Fall of 2001 largely in one session at the band's rehearsal space. Some songs were written and recorded on the spot, while others had small edits performed shortly afterward. The style of this record is more raw and punk-like grindcore that is different than most other Fuck the Facts releases.
